Item Trajetórias de vida: caminhos percorridos pelos estudantes da educação de jovens e adultos durante a sua vida escolar(2019-02-12) Silva, Danielle Maria Braga da; Nova, Taynah de Brito Barra; http://lattes.cnpq.br/1093805068631305; http://lattes.cnpq.br/9093146079896441This work had as general objective to analyze the relation of the student of Education of Young and Adults of the municipality of São João / PE with the school institution in its life trajectories. To reach it, we propose to know, through narratives of life stories, the school journey of the students of the EJA; identify which were the main difficulties encountered by students during their school life; and to establish relations between these difficulties and the meanings attributed by them to the school. We developed our research in a group of 1st and 2nd stage of Education of Young and Adults of a municipal school of São João, Pernambuco. From the Narrative Interview, based on the Oral Life Stories, we collected data with ten students. Our analysis of the narratives gave rise to four categories. The first category, entitled The school comprised in childhood, depicts the memories built on the school institution during the childhood of the student of the EJA. The Reflections on School Life category presents our analysis of the statements that involve the students' memories about the experiences they have had in relation to school. The stimulation to go to school in childhood and adulthood is treated in this third category. The elements that we have here clarify to us how the family has weight in the decisions of the research subjects. In the category The school for life ... The life beyond school, we approach a school overvalued by the students of the EJA. If on the one hand they acknowledge that life can teach, on the other they report that it is the school that can make them, in short, have an easier life, if only, by learning to read and write.
